On April 29, 2026, at approximately 4:23 PM Lycoming Regional Police were dispatched to a disturbance between two females at Weis Markets, 1916 Lycoming Creek Rd. in Old Lycoming Township. The incident stemmed from an ongoing issue involving an ex-boyfriend and his current girlfriend.
One of the females, who was upset about the other taking pictures of her child at a sporting event and not responding to Facebook messages, approached the other inside the store. The situation escalated when the second female made threatening statements over the phone and then physically attacked the first female. The altercation continued until the two were separated and the actor fled the store.
Officers observed injuries on the victim, including redness on the left side of her face near her temple and a small nail mark. Witnesses corroborated the victim's account, stating they overheard the threatening statements and saw the physical altercation.
The victim was provided with a victim's rights pamphlet. The other female was issued a summary citation for harassment.
